What makes Dan Florez's role particularly fascinating is his focus on the human element within the Artemis missions. As a test director, he is responsible for planning and executing integrated testing, a task that is both complex and crucial. The Artemis program, with its ambitious goals of returning humans to the Moon and eventually Mars, demands a meticulous approach to testing, especially when it comes to the safety and well-being of the astronauts.
One of the key challenges Florez and his team face is the integration of the crew timeline into the launch countdown. This means ensuring that the astronauts are safely inside the spacecraft, all systems are checked out, and the spacecraft is ready for launch, all while managing the complexities of cryogenic propellant loading and launch abort scenarios. It's a delicate balance, and Florez's expertise lies in navigating this intricate web of procedures and timelines.
What many people don't realize is the sheer scale of the task. The test directors, a dedicated group of 20 engineers, are responsible for developing timelines and procedures for a multitude of scenarios, from launch countdown to emergency egress and recovery operations. Each Artemis mission, like Artemis I and the upcoming Artemis II, presents unique challenges that require innovative solutions and meticulous planning.
